python输入错误后删除的方法
python输入错误怎么删除?
python常用的输入函数raw_input()在输入的过程中如果输错了,不能像在命令行下那样backspace取消已输入的字符,还得重新再输入。
怎么才能实现类似命令行那样可以把已输入的字符backspace取消掉?
这个问题是因为不同的操作系统造成的:
● 在Windows操作系统下,raw_input()在输入的过程中如果输错了,可以使用backspace取消已输入的字符;
● 在有些类Unix系统里,删除要用delete,而不是backspace;
● 在Ubuntu下,delete也是不行的,但是ctrl+backspace是可以的。
扩展学习
python输入过程中怎样取消已输入的错误字符?
这个问题是因为不同的操作系统造成的:
在Windows操作系统下,raw_input()在输入的过程中如果输错了,可以使用backspace取消已输入的字符;
在有些类Unix系统里,删除要用delete,而不是backspace;
在Ubuntu下,delete也是不行的,但是ctrl+backspace是可以的。
以上就是本次介绍的全部相关知识点,感谢大家的学习和对我们的支持。
相关推荐
-
python输入错误后删除的方法
python输入错误怎么删除? python常用的输入函数raw_input()在输入的过程中如果输错了,不能像在命令行下那样backspace取消已输入的字符,还得重新再输入. 怎么才能实现类似命令行那样可以把已输入的字符backspace取消掉? 这个问题是因为不同的操作系统造成的: ● 在Windows操作系统下,raw_input()在输入的过程中如果输错了,可以使用backspace取消已输入的字符: ● 在有些类Unix系统里,删除要用delete,而不是backspace: ● 在
-
python输入错误密码用户锁定实现方法
小编给大家带来了用python实现用户多次密码输入错误后,用户锁定的实现方式,以及具体的流程,让大家更好的理解运行的过程. 1.新建一个文件,用以存放白名单用户(正确注册的用户 格式:username:password),再建一个文件,用以存放黑名单用户(输入三次用户名均错误的用户). 2.读取白名单文件,将内容赋值给一个变量,并关闭. 3.将变量以" :"分割,分割出得第一位(索引为0)赋值给username,第二位(索引为1)赋值给password. 4.读取黑名单文件,将内容赋值
-
对Python 字典元素进行删除的方法
1. Python字典的clear()方法(删除字典内所有元素) #!/usr/bin/python # -*- coding: UTF-8 -*- dict = {'name': '我的博客地址', 'alexa': 10000, 'url': 'http://blog.csdn.net/uuihoo/'} dict.clear(); # 清空词典所有条目 2. Python字典的pop()方法(删除字典给定键 key 所对应的值,返回值为被删除的值) #!/usr/bin/python #
-
python输入多行字符串的方法总结
Python中输入多行字符串: 方法一:使用三引号 >>> str1 = '''Le vent se lève, il faut tenter de vivre. 起风了,唯有努力生存. (纵有疾风起,人生不言弃.)''' >>> str1 'Le vent se lève, il faut tenter de vivre. \n起风了,唯有努力生存.\n(纵有疾风起,人生不言弃.)' >>> print(str1) Le vent se lève,
-
python中delattr删除对象方法的代码分析
最近我们针对对象属性这块,介绍了不少关于测试属性的方法.在进行一系列测试后,我们发现这个属性并不需要,这时候就要用到删除的功能.在python中可以选择delattr函数删除对象的属性,基于它的删除功能,是否能扩展到删除的对象的方法上,在我们对delattr函数进行全面了解后,展开实例的测试. 1.说明 函数作用用来删除指定对象的指定名称的属性,和setattr函数作用相反. 不能删除对象的方法. 2.参数 object -- 对象. name -- 必须是对象的属性. 3.返回值 无. 4.实
-
C/C++中输入多组数据的方法
如果在刚开始学习算法,做算法题的时候,题上经常会要求输入多组数据,对于刚开始学习的小白来说,可能不知道怎么算输入多组数据,也不知道该怎么处理,刚好想起来,就把方法记录一下 怎么算输入多组数据? 一般题中要求输入多组数据的意思就是读取数量不定的输入数据(不能确定输入数据的数量),在这种情况下,需要不断读取数据直至没有新的输入为止. 方法一: #include <stdio.h> int main() { int a; while(scanf("%d",&a)!=EOF
-
Python实现用户登录并且输入错误三次后锁定该用户
实现用户登录并且输入错误三次后锁定该用户 我的测试环境,win7,python3.5.1 提示输入用户名,和密码 判断是否被锁定 判断用户名和密码是否匹配 输入错误三次,账号被锁定 思路 代码块 name = 'alex' #正确的用户名 passwd = '123456' #正确的密码 lock_usr = [] #锁定账号列表 for i in range(0,3): usr_name = input("用户名:") usr_passwd = input("密码:&quo
-
python判断图片宽度和高度后删除图片的方法
本文实例讲述了python判断图片宽度和高度后删除图片的方法.分享给大家供大家参考.具体分析如下: Image对象有open方法却没有close方法,如果打开图片,判断图片高度和宽度,判断完成后希望删除或者给图片改名,是无法操作的,这段代码可以解决这个问题,注意open函数打开图片文件要使用二进制方式,及参数使用'rb',有的文章给出的只有个'r'参数,Image是无法open的 import os import Image fileName = 'c:/py/jb51.jpg' fp = op
-
Python实现连接两个无规则列表后删除重复元素并升序排序的方法
本文实例讲述了Python实现连接两个无规则列表后删除重复元素并升序排序的方法.分享给大家供大家参考,具体如下: # -*- coding:utf-8 -*- #! python2 list_one=[3,6,2,17,7,33,11,7] list_two=[1,2,3,7,4,2,17,33,11] list_new=list_one+list_two list=[] i=0 for x in list_new : if x not in list : list.append(x) list
-
linux输入yum后提示: -bash: /usr/bin/yum: No such file or directory的解决方法
linux输入yum后提示: -bash: /usr/bin/yum: No such file or directory的解决方案 今天在安装程序时,发现有一个插件未安装,我就随手敲了一个命令,看都没看 yum remove yum 然后就杯具了... [root@localhost ~]# yum -bash: /usr/bin/yum: No such file or directory 这个粗心的手误倒不至于让整个系统瘫痪,yum 却无法使用了.于是,我试着折腾了一番 rpm -ivh
随机推荐
- Lua教程(一):Lua脚本语言介绍
- jquery+CSS3实现3D拖拽相册效果
- ASP.NET中FileUpload文件上传控件应用实例
- javascript 在网页中的运用(asp.net)
- 可以查询系统用户名sid的vbs
- 提示Outlook/Foxmail收取163邮件失败:ERR 您没有权限使用pop3功能
- Visual Studio 未能加载各种Package包的解决方案
- IE、FF浏览器下修改标签透明度
- 基于JS实现的倒计时程序实例
- JavaScript知识点总结之如何提高性能
- ASP中用ajax方式获得session的实现代码
- javascript 实现页面加载进度条代码
- jquery.gridrotator实现响应式图片展示画廊效果
- 详解Nginx几种常见实现301重定向方法上的区别
- 捕获未处理的Promise错误方法
- 使用Android系统提供的DownloadManager来下载文件
- 伍捌捌为您提供50M/可绑米的FTP免费空间
- Maven引入本地Jar包并打包进War包中的方法
- C/C++中接收return返回来的数组元素方法示例
- spring boot系列之集成测试(推荐)